Method of controlling an automotive vehicle having a trailer using rear axle slip angle

1. A control system for an automotive vehicle and a trailer comprising:

  • means to determine the presence of the trailer;

    a vehicle velocity sensor generating a vehicle velocity signal;

    a steering wheel angle sensor generating a steering wheel angle signal; and

    a controller coupled to the means, the velocity sensor and the steering angle sensor, said controller determining a rear axle side slip angle of the vehicle, and when the rear axle side slip angle is above a predetermined rear axle slip angle, the vehicle velocity signal is above a velocity threshold and the steering wheel angle is about zero, said controller programmed to apply brake-steer to the vehicle to stabilize the vehicle and trailer further in response to a reverse direction signal.
